Introduction
A key element of the GLOBALG.A.P. Standard integrity is the principle of identifying GLOBALG.A.P. certified producers as unique identities and recording all relevant producer and product information - including the certificate. For this purpose GLOBALG.A.P. operates a database of all GLOBALG.A.P. certified producers worldwide. This section introduces the database tasks managed by GLOBALG.A.P. approved Certification Bodies: registration of producers, products and certification of products. Crucial is the assignment of the GLOBALG.A.P. Number (GGN) during producer registration. This 13-digit number is unique and belongs to the legal entity as long as it exists. It serves as a search key on the GLOBALG.A.P. website for validating certificates.
Training database
GLOBALG.A.P. is operating a training database, available for tests or trainings and works exactly as the “real” database. Note that the data is not saved permanently in this database and any actions executed in the training database are not invoiced. Data in the training database get updated monthly. Every employee of a GLOBALG.A.P. Certification Body can log in to the training database with the same login and password combination as in the regular database.

Friend of the Sea Add-on for Aquaculture
The registration process for this add-on is the same as for IFA. Please make sure to assign FOS scheme (Friend of the Sea) and relevant sub-scopes to the auditors/inspectors/CB-Committees before you start to work with a GGN. The FOS products are the same ones as for IFA Aquaculture (please refer to our official product list or product upload sheet). The quantities, entered under FOS, are also the same ones as for IFA Aquaculture.
For more detailed information please refer to the communication from 27.11.2014 Implementation of the new Friend of the Sea module for Aquaculture.
